Issues unresolved
Audio stuttering
- No permanent fix.
- Some of these fixes worked:
- Disable vertical synchronization
- Set process priority to
High
forSpaceMarine.exe
process.

Notes
- ↑ 1.0 1.1 Notes regarding Steam Play (Linux) data:
- File/folder structure within this directory reflects the path(s) listed for Windows and/or Steam game data.
- Games with Steam Cloud support may also store data in
~/.steam/steam/userdata/<user-id>/55150/
. - Use Wine's registry editor to access any Windows registry paths.
- The app ID (55150) may differ in some cases.
- Treat backslashes as forward slashes.
- See the glossary page for details on Windows data paths.
